Porsche 944 S
Biggar
£2,500

so regretfully putting this up for sale. Overall a fairly solid car but does need a bit of love to get it back to the standard it deserves to be. Starts no problem and drives, although ive driven it the grand total of 200 yards so can't say much about that. 
Main issue with the car is an immobiliser fault so fuel pump relay has to be bridged, my plan was to remove the alarm and immobiliser and start again. Does have a brand new pump fitted though. Other than that reattaching trim panels and some gentle recommissioning should see you with a lovely appreciating classic
Prices seem to be quite difficult to gauge on these but I feel it's easily worth the asking price
